The bovine cancellous bone, demineralized bone, composite scaffold were investigated and characterized by FTIR, SEM, XRD and universal electromechanical testing machine. The results show that the compressive strength of the demineralized bones is about (1.10±0.31)MPa, the porosity is about 71% and the pore size is in the range from 200 to 600μm. However, the porosity and the compressive strength of the composite scaffolds are decreased to 40% and increase markedly to (8.49±2.14)MPa, respectively. Meanwhile, the composite scaffolds show good bioactivity in vitro. %K mesoporous bioactive glass %K demineralized bone %K composite scaffold %K bioactivity %U http://www.jim.org.cn/fileup/PDF/20111011.pdf
